It's not even pathless, but good to know exactly where you'll descend. Orientation poor, especially if some unpredictable fog comes. Easier descent variant is drop from bivouac Busettini/Tarvisio towards Koritnica and there left towards Kotovo sedlo. That's a marked path, though it's not on the net. Condition of that path is good fitness, since the path is quite long especially that gully that brings you to Kotovo sedlo

djimuzl12. 07. 2017 18:06:36
From Belopeška Lakes the two most commonly "used" paths are. First path goes past Zacchi hut to Middle and Rear Ponca and further across Strug - which is very demanding - and from Middle Ponca onwards practically unsecured, second path is Via della Vita, which goes across Zagače and is also very demanding, but secured climbing path - ferrata. For both paths appropriate knowledge and protection or mountain guide leadership is recommended. There is also a third variant, Kugy path - from Zacchi to the ridge between Strug and Rear Ponca, where it joins the first path, here mountain guide is highly recommended. Good luck!

djimuzl21. 08. 2018 14:40:06
I headed to Vevnica from Loška Koritnica. Early enough start gave me shade all the way to the bivouac, otherwise not much sun on the path later either..
The marked path to Rob nad Zagačami (branching off the "main" Mangart path) is unprotected and from the start under and on the ledges to the bivouac it's finely scree-loaded due to erosion, helmet mandatory..
On the path to the saddle under Vevnica and V Konec špica at the start of the secured path for safer continuation one (first) cable is missing, felt its absence most on wet rock on descent, later no problems.
Returned to Koritnica via old mulatiera under walls of Mali Koritniški Mangart. Not too overgrown, slightly collapsed in places, but mostly followable. A bit "slower" than marked path but nicer due to grass, and if something flies down from under Kotova špica nasmeh also safer.

mirank18. 08. 2020 21:43:06
Our 7am start from Koritnica was early enough for shade almost to the bivouac. Thanks to hunters for exemplary path maintenance to hunting hut. From there we stuck to old mulatiera trace, definitely better ascent choice avoiding scree on marked path; not speaking of alpine flowers. Last 100 m height better follow unmarked path crossing under rock barrier on ledge right to left to grass by bivouac. From bivouac path from Rob nad Zagačami slightly descends to junction with Via della vita. Ascent from there to saddle between Vevnica and V Konec špica goes below over wet rocks. Summit view definitely worth it, enjoyed briefly as SW wind started bringing fog.
